Output db776d115fbfd3f5d8c91251408274276cefc5adc1c00eb620265f063117e1b6:0

value
185359043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bbb9b94c75e185f28a88683a213273631c07a48 OP_EQUAL
address
38bTM9NuSpMz31gTGB91stsfs5U3ZhL6zi
transaction
db776d115fbfd3f5d8c91251408274276cefc5adc1c00eb620265f063117e1b6
spent
true